Quick note for new starters: the lifts at Oakhenge Plaza are serviced most weekends, so expect them offline Saturday mornings. Visitors should be walked via the north stairs instead — it's a short climb. The stair door stays locked on weekends, so let your guests through using the door code below.

staff pass of kawip-hawef = bdg-QLP-2

Ticket #— Floor 9 Opening Prep, Brindlemoor House

Hi facilities folks, Floor 9 opens to staff next Monday and we need a few things squared away before then. Lift access is live, but the two side doors by the kitchenette are still on the old lock config — please reprogram them before Friday. Also, signage for the quiet rooms hasn't arrived, so pop up the temporary printed ones for now. Until the badge readers sync, the interim door code for Floor 9 is below.

door code, bajop-bajog: bdg-DSWAC-43621

Subject: Billing worker cut-over — done!

Hey all, the blue-green swap for the Ledgerly billing worker finished last night without a hitch. Green took full traffic at 02:10, blue drained cleanly, and no invoices were dropped. Rollback window closes Friday, so keep an eye on retry queues until then. For anyone maintaining this later, the green environment now runs with the following settings.

settings of fafog-haduf:
ZORIX_PIN=4648
ZORIX_METRICS_HOST=metrics.zorix.paliqsys.corp
ZORIX_LOG_LEVEL=info
ZORIX_TENANT=druix

Hey release folks — quick one for review. I wired up incremental rebuilds for the Marrowfield docs site, so touching one page no longer rebuilds all 3,000. Cache keys are content-hashed; full rebuild still runs nightly as a safety net. Would love eyes on the invalidation logic before Friday. The candidate build is identified below.

pipeline stamp: htk3_cc5

## Tuning

The Wrenfield solver uses simulated annealing over timetable swaps. Reviewers should note that cooling rate and restart count dominate solve quality; the weight constants merely trade teacher-gap penalties against room-change penalties. All values were validated against the Ashgrove Academy benchmark set. The defaults compiled into the solver are as follows.

tuning table, faduf-baduf:
PRIORITIES = {
    "ulavan": 191,
    "silys": 750,
    "goriel": 238,
    "kelmir": 66,
    "wendor": 432,
}